Vietnamese Meatball Lettuce Wraps with Mango Salad + Cilantro-Basil Cashew Sauce.
They're basically like a salad, but so much more fun!
👥 4 Servings⏱️ Prep & Cook: 30 min⏳ Prep: 20 min🔥 Cook: 10 min👤 Tieghan Gerard📖 halfbakedharvest

📝 Preparation Steps
1
Salad
2
In a bowl, combine the mangos, carrots, cucumbers, red onion, red fresno pepper and a squeeze of fresh lime juice. Toss well. Store in the fridge until ready to serv. Toss in the nuts just before serving.
mango (peeled and julienned (sliced into thin strips))1carrots (cut into small matchsticks)1cucumber (cut into small matchsticks)1red onion (sliced thin (optional))1
3
Green Cashew Sauce
4
Add the cilantro, basil, cashews, coconut milk lime juice, thai red curry paste and sweet thai chile sauce to a blender or food processor. Blend until completely smooth and creamy, about ⏱️ 3-5 minutes. Taste and adjust as needed, adding more sweet thai chile sauce if desired. Can be store in the fridge for 1 week.
thai red curry paste1 teaspoon
5
Wraps
6
Season the pork with salt and pepper and then roll into 20-30 tablespoon size meatballs, place each meatball on a tray as you work. In a small bowl, combine the sesame oil, soy sauce, fish sauce and honey.
sesame oil2 tablespoonsfish sauce (check for gluten free labels if needed)2 tablespoonshoney2 tablespoons
7
Heat a large skillet over medium heat and cook the meatballs until cooked through, about ⏱️ 5 minutes, turning them 2-3 times throughout cooking. During the last minute or so of cooking, add the sauce and give the meatballs a good toss through the sauce. Cook another minute longer you until the sauce glazes the meatballs. Remove from the heat.
8
To serve, double up your lettuce leafs and divide the meatballs among the leaves. Top with mango salad and the cashew sauce. Eat!
